Transaction 7905310379808e6ee4e06c1779852b83a3482f0a6bea830a52e824de22611149

1 Input
2 Outputs
  • 7905310379808e6ee4e06c1779852b83a3482f0a6bea830a52e824de22611149:0
  • value  1063657
    address  3FSRE8pomj6oF1Caen1i7arhZ22bxWnjVb
  • 7905310379808e6ee4e06c1779852b83a3482f0a6bea830a52e824de22611149:1
  • value  10511183
    address  bc1q2ev3ll8t76ymhqjylplpq537v32xll98c59dge